Relationship between topochemical indices and anti-HIV-1 (HTLV-III) inhibitory activity of 1-alkoxy-5-alkyl-6-(arylthio)uracils has been studied. Superadjacency, an adjacency-cum-distance-based, topochemical index and Wiener’s, a distance-based, topochemical index were calculated for a set of 36 1-alkoxy-5-alkyl-6-(arylthio)uracils. Resulting data were analyzed and suitable models were developed after identification of the active ranges. Subsequently, a biological activity was assigned to each of the compounds using these models and compared with the reported anti-HIV-1 activity. High accuracy of prediction was observed using these models. Statistical analysis revealed significance of the proposed models as well as a lack of correlation between the topochemical indices employed for the chosen data set.  相似文献

以扩展连接矩阵EA的幂级数函数为基础,建立了一个新的拓扑指数EATI,该指数对1~22个碳原子的所有3807434个烷烃异构体的指认并不出现简并,且能区分含杂原子的化合物,其唯一性良好。该指数可用于数据库中替代CAS登录号进行结构的编码、管理及检索。  相似文献

Relationship between topochemical indices and inhibition of CDK2/cyclin A by 3-aminopyrazoles was investigated using a data set comprising of 42 3-aminopyrazoles. Three topochemical indices--the Wiener's topochemical index--a distance based topochemical index, atomic molecular connectivity index--an adjacency based topochemical index and superadjacency topochemical index--an adjacency-cum-distance based topochemical index were used for the present investigations. The values of Wiener's topochemical index, atomic molecular connectivity index and superadjacency topochemical index for each of the 42 compounds comprising the data set were computed using an in-house computer program. Resultant data was subsequently analyzed and suitable models were developed after identification of the active ranges. Subsequently, a biological activity was assigned to each of the compounds using these models, which was then compared with the reported CDK2/cyclin A inhibitory activity. High accuracy of prediction ranging from 86 to 89% was observed using these models.  相似文献

The relationship between Wiener's topological index and the antiepileptic activity of a series ofN-aryl-isoxazole carboxamides/N-isoxazolylbenzamide analogs has been investigated. Values of Wiener's topological index for 69 compounds constituting the training set were computed and an active range was identified. Each analog was subsequently assigned an activity which was then compared with the reported antiepileptic activity against the maximal electroshock seizure (MES) test. Due to significant correlation between antiepileptic activity and Wiener's topological index, it was possible to predict antiepileptic activity with an accuracy of 91 % in the active range.  相似文献

A simple pictorial algorithm for factorisation of symmetric chemical graphs (weighted and unweighted) leading to simultaneous determination of their eigenvalues and eigenvectors has been devised. The method does not require group-theoretical techniques (viz. identification of the point group of the species under study, formation of symmetryadopted linear combinations using character tables etc.). It requires consideration of only one symmetry element, e.g., a reflection plane and is based on elementary row and column operations which keep the secular determinant of the adjacency matrix unchanged (except possibly for a multiplicative constant).  相似文献

Spectropolarimetric back-titrations are described for rhodium(III); the optically active ligand (R, R)-(-)-t?ans-l, 2-cyclohexanediaminetetraacetic acid (R, R(-)CDTA) is used as the complexing agent and cadmium(II) ion as the back-titrant. The optical rotation is monitored throughout the titration, and the optically active ligand and stereospecifically formed complexes serve as self-indicators. The end points are determined graphically by straight-line extrapolations from a plot of volume-corrected observed rotations versus ml of titrant. The rhodium(III) titration plots are representative of normal spectro-polarimetric back-titrations. The range of analyses of rhodium(III) was from 40–0.5 mg.  相似文献

N-Acetic acid derivatives of 6-aryl-pyrazolo-triazin-4-ones were synthesized for evaluation as new aldose reductase inhibitors. The intrinsic activity of each compound was assessed by measuring the inhibition of enzymatic activity in an isolated pig lens enzyme preparation. All the prepared compounds exhibited a significant in vitro aldose reductase inhibitory effect (10(-6) M less than or equal to IC50 less than or equal to 10(-4) M). Furthermore, biological activity (log 1/IC50) for most of the data sets could be correlated directly to electronic and steric parameters. Finally, spatial configuration of the most active derivative 6c (IC50 = 2 x 10(-6) M) was compared with that of tolrestat and with pharmacophor requirements of the aldose reductase inhibitor site using a molecular modeling system.  相似文献

A fluorous-tagged linker for the parallel synthesis of small- and medium-ring and macrocyclic nitrogen heterocycles using ring-closing metathesis is described. The linker was designed such that "cyclization-release" of the cyclic heterocyclic products was coupled with liberation of the active catalyst. The design of the linker was validated using a non-fluorous-tagged model. A wide range of unsaturated alcohols were used as reagents to functionalize a fluorous-tagged sulfonamide, (Z)-{N-[4-(2-(N'-3,3,4,4,5,5,6,6,7,7,8,8,9,9,10,10,10-heptadecafluorodecyl)-4-methylsulfonamido)methylallyloxy]but-2-enyl}-2-nitrobenzenesulfonamide, using Fukuyama-Mitsunobu reactions; in each case, fluorous-solid-phase extraction (F-SPE) was used to purify the functionalized linker from the excess reagents. In general, the "cyclization-release" of cyclic products was triggered using a light-fluorous tagged derivative of the Grubbs-Hoveyda second-generation catalyst. After the metathesis step, F-SPE was used to purify released cyclic compounds from the fluorous-tagged linker and the fluorous-tagged catalyst. The scope and limitations of the approach were determined using a range of substrates which probed different aspects of the functionalization and metathesis steps. In the study as a whole, a wide range of small- and medium-ring and macrocyclic nitrogen heterocycles were prepared using polyene and polyenyne metathesis cascades.  相似文献

A new facile route for synthesis of 3-(aryl)-8,9-diphenylfuro[3,2-e][1,2,4]triazolo pyrimidines derivative from the same starting material, 2-amino-4,5-diphenylfuran-3-carbonitrile, has been developed through heterocyclization of the corresponding arylidene-hydrazono-5,6-diphenylfuro[2,3-d]pyrimidine and N-(arylmethylene)-4-imino-5,6-diphenylfuro[2,3-d]pyrimidin-3(4H)-amine under refluxing condition with acetic anhydride followed by air oxidation. The products were obtained in good yield with an easy workup along with the purification of products by a nonchromatographic method. This general synthetic procedure can be extended to the preparation of a wide range of isomeric triazoles using 2-amino 3-carbonitrile bifunctional derivatives.  相似文献

以2,3-二(溴甲基)喹喔啉为原料,以N-溴琥珀酰亚胺为溴化试剂合成了2-溴甲基-3-(二溴甲基)喹喔啉(1),1是Diels-Alder环加成反应中形成含杂原子环的C60衍生物的一种重要中间体。通过IR,^1H NMR,^13C NMR,DEPT谱和MS对其进行了结构表征。  相似文献

One new 2-arylbenzofuran derivative, artocarstilbene B(1), one new benzaldehyde derivative,(E)-3,5-dihydroxy-4-(3-methylbut-1-enyl)benzaldehyde(2), as well as 18 known compounds(3–20) were obtained from the leaves of Artocarpus heterophyllus. Their structures were elucidated on the basis of extensive spectroscopic techniques including 2D NMR and HR-ESIMS. Many compounds exhibited moderate to weak inhibitory activity against the proliferation of the PC-3, NCI-H460, and A549 cancer cell lines.  相似文献

为了研究由四元环和六元环构成的碳多面体(F4F6多面体)的结构和稳定性之间的关系, 本文采用密度泛函方法对所有C8~C60之间的F4F6多面体进行了系统的计算研究. 结果表明, 能量最低的异构体都满足独立四元环原则, 能量较低的满足四元环比邻惩罚原则. 这两条原则与经典富勒烯所遵循的独立五元环原则和五元环比邻惩罚原则具有同等地位, 能够使研究者仅仅从形貌上就可以对碳F4F6多面体的稳定性进行简单高效的判定. 结构分析表明, 四元环之间共用的顶点的锥化角大于其他顶点的锥化角并决定了相应分子的稳定性.  相似文献

To gain insight into the structures and stability of F4F6 polyhedrons formed by squares and hexagons, a density functional theory study was performed on all isomers of F4F6 polyhedrons with sizes from 8 to 60. The calculated results demonstrate that the six squares tend to isolate from each other, i.e. these F4F6 polyhedrons obey the isolated square rule. Those isomers with fewer B44 bonds (square-square adjacencies) are more stable than those with more B44 bonds, i.e. they obey square adjacency penalty rule. Both of the two rules in F4F6 polyhedrons are in the same status as the isolated pentagon rule and pentagon adjacency penalty rule in F5F6 fullerenes and can be used to screen the lowest energy isomers of F4F6 polyhedrons as IPR and PAPR do in classic fullerenes. Structural analysis demonstrates that the pyramidalization of carbon atoms at the square-square adjacencies determines the stability of corresponding structures.
